Urban Decay Get Baked for Summer!

Urban Decay Get Baked for Summer!

Urban Decay Get Baked Eye Kit ($28.00) includes Baked, Half Baked, Twice Baked, and Flipside eyeshadows, along with a travel-sized 24/7 Eye Pencil in Bourbon. It also comes with a mini Sin primer potion.

Prescriptives' Motor-Eyes Instant Action Mascara Review

Prescriptives' Motor-Eyes Instant Action Mascara Review

Prescriptives' Motor-Eyes Instant Action Mascara ($32.00) is designed to increase volume, blacken lashes, and lift and curl all with a vibrating mascara brush. The brush is supposed to keep the mascara moving and "work synergistically" with your lashes.
